Main Creator: Hayes, Stephen
Summary:Hopes that the confession will "undo some of the harm and injury I done to Óglaigh na hÉireann through my co-operation with them", details his involvement with the I.R.A. and connection to members of the Government Party, mentions his relationship with Larry de Lacey and lists de Lacey's military, government and civilian connections.
